Detailed 7-Day Kenya Safari Itinerary

Day 1: Travel to Masai Mara National Reserve – Home of the Wildebeests
Masai Mara National Reserve is located in southwest Kenya. It is a wide open Savannah and home to the Big Five animals and the famous wildebeest migration. The park covers about 1,510 square kilometers, and the drive from Nairobi takes around six hours.
You will begin your journey from Nairobi, passing through Narok County and enjoying views of the Great Rift Valley. Arrive at your lodge or camp in time for lunch, and spend the evening relaxing.
Day 2: Full-Day Game Drive in Masai Mara
After breakfast, head out for a full day of wildlife viewing in Masai Mara. You will see animals such as buffaloes, cheetahs, giraffes, elephants, rhinos, zebras, lions, leopards, wildebeests, and many birds.
Lunch will be served in the park as you continue watching animals move freely in the wild. In the afternoon, go for another game drive. If the season is right, visit the Mara River to see the wildebeest migration, one of the world’s most famous wildlife events.
Day 3: Morning Game Drive & Masai Cultural Visit
Start your day with an early breakfast followed by a morning game drive in Masai Mara. This is a good time to spot more animals and take photos. In the afternoon, visit a Masai village to learn about their culture and daily life. Enjoy their dances, songs, and traditional customs.
Day 4: Drive to Lake Nakuru – The Land of Flamingos
After breakfast, leave Masai Mara and drive to Lake Nakuru National Park, known as a birdwatcher’s paradise. You will arrive in the afternoon and have lunch before going for an evening game drive. Look out for animals such as buffaloes, waterbucks, hyenas, zebras, rhinos, impalas, leopards, gazelles, lions, and many bird species.
Day 5: Morning Game Drive & Transfer to Amboseli National Park
Enjoy tea or coffee before your morning game drive in Lake Nakuru. You will see more animals and birds, including flamingos. Later, continue your journey to Amboseli National Park in the Loitoktok District of the Rift Valley region.
Day 6: Full-Day Game Viewing in Amboseli
Spend the day exploring Amboseli National Park. The park is famous for its large herds of elephants and clear views of Mount Kilimanjaro. Look out for animals such as elephants, antelopes, buffaloes, lions, elands, cheetahs, and many birds. Enjoy a picnic lunch or return to your lodge for meals, depending on your guide’s plan.
Day 7: Return to Nairobi
After breakfast, check out of your lodge and begin your drive back to Nairobi. Enjoy a short game drive as you leave the park. On arrival in Nairobi, you will be dropped off at your hotel or the airport.
This marks the end of your 7-day Kenya Safari.
